Output 17676122e306611b4b2e5af9e02c969f5650cf87d9834a9a5aee1d7d11ae79d5:1

value
12752796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8358f9028d5b2eaca5ea382254038424adaa1c2f OP_EQUAL
address
MKsfLVSgvTB37eEdDGSbHq8KDuJdtv3v24
transaction
17676122e306611b4b2e5af9e02c969f5650cf87d9834a9a5aee1d7d11ae79d5
spent
true